Model for the tomb of Maerten Harpertsz Tromp
In his design for the tomb of Maerten Harpertsz Tromp, Rombout Verhulst chose to represent the naval hero wearing his armour, his head resting on a cannon, with the medal he was once awarded in one hand, his commander’s baton in the other. The admiral was killed on 3 August 1653 off the cost of South Holland by English cannon fire. His real tomb is made of marble and stands in the Oude Kerk in Delft.
